Concho Valley Transit District Salary

As of August 2026, the average hourly salary for employees at Concho Valley Transit District in the United States is $31. This translates to an approximate annual wage of $64,437. Salaries at Concho Valley Transit District typically range from $27 to $35 hourly, reflecting the diverse roles and experience levels within the company.

What Is the Cost of Living Near Abilene?

Understanding the cost of living near Abilene is key to truly evaluating a salary offer or your current compensation at Concho Valley Transit District.
Abilene's Cost of Living Index is approximately 80.1 (19.9% less expensive than US average; 13.9% less than TX average). West TX city (Dyess AFB), very affordable. CityLink. When planning your budget based on a salary from Concho Valley Transit District, consider these typical monthly expenses:
